How to Measure Success in a B2B Content Syndication Campaign

 For many organizations, B2B Content Syndication has emerged as a critical strategy for expanding reach, enhancing brand credibility, and driving meaningful b2b lead generation. Nevertheless, the true value of any syndication campaign stems from how accurately it can measure success. By leveraging metrics and analytics frameworks like marketing attribution models, marketers can not only prove ROI but also optimize future campaigns for even greater impact.

Understanding B2B Content Syndication Campaigns

As the name suggests, b2b content syndication entails sharing valuable b2b content (whitepapers, case studies or webinars) through third-party platforms to broaden your targeted reach. The objectives associated with this is to generate leads and nurture prospects through a defined customer journey until they are ready to convert into customers. Having a robust measurement framework helps ascertain whether the investment in content syndication services yields tangible results.

Key Metrics for Measuring Success

1. Lead Volume and Quality

  • Lead Volume: Capture the cumulative number of leads generated through your syndication campaign, this will help track campaign performance within set benchmarks.
  • Lead Quality: Additionally assess how many leads qualify as marketing qualified leads (MQL) or sales qualified leads (SQL). Higher quality often indicates increased chances of conversion.

2. Engagement Metrics

  • Impressions: This describes the frequency with which your content appears on syndication platforms. High impressions demonstrate broad reach which is especially important for brand visibility campaigns.
  • Click-Through Rate (CTR): An important engagement metric measuring the percentage of users that click on a link to at least view your website or landing page. Strong CTR means that your audience actively engages with your content by clicking on it.
  • Time on Page: Tells you how long visitors spend engaging with each piece of content. Longer time spent often indicates that the audience considers the information useful and pertinent.
  • Bounce Rate: Percentage of visitors who only interact with one page before leaving the site, Lower bounce rate means more visitors are engaging with additional pages on your site due to well-structured compelling content.

3. Conversion and ROI Metrics

  • Conversion Rate: A measure of leads generated divided by those completing actions such as filling out forms or downloading a given resource guide, Effective content directly influences wanted business activities – key marketing goals.
  • Cost Per Lead (CPL): Gets calculated after dividing total syndication spend into countable leads. Focused tracking of CPL value assists in determining cost efficiency and growth potential easily as far as b2b content syndication services are concerned.
  • Return on Investment (ROI): Assess profit derived from syndicated leads against total campaign expenditure. A positive ROI validates that efforts are aiding business growth.

Best Practices for Accurate Measurement

  • Set Clear Objectives: Measure specific objectives such as campaign lead volume, quality or revenue targets you wish to achieve. Clarity enables tracking of relevant metrics.
  • Align Metrics with Goals: Select KPIs that represent the goals with measurable outcomes. For brand awareness use impressions and CTR; for lead generation focus on conversion rate alongside lead quality evaluation.
  • Use Analytics Tools: Utilize Google Analytics alongside other marketing automation tools to evaluate user interactions, attribution sources, and engagement levels within syndicated channels.
  • Monitor and Optimize: Conduct routine reviews of set metrics in order to identify trends then adjust strategies accordingly. Consistent optimization of b2b lead generation efforts is essential in achieving ideal results.
  • Implement UTM Parameters: Properly tag your URLs to grant access to specific traffic and conversions for syndication partners or campaigns resulting in granular performance evaluation.
